Since it's a rental, we weren't able to paint.
But, pillows, throws and some creative pieces of furniture turn blahh, to BAMM!


A trip to HomeGoods and a discarded dutch door fill out the center of the room.


I had this dutch door coffee table made especially for Brooke. We left most of the hardware.


A bottom shelf was crated from pallett wood.



I added some color and a larger piece under the tv.
